Grilled Beef Kebabs

Prep time: 6 – 8 hours
Cook time: 12 minutes
Makes 3 – 4 servings


For the Beef Kebabs

1 bottle Kikkoman® Teriyaki Marinade & Sauce, plus extra for brushing
1 1/2 pounds beef sirloin tips, cut into 1 1/2-inch cubes
1 large sweet onion, cut into 1 1/2-inch cubes
1 red bell pepper, cut into 1 1/2-inch squares
1 yellow bell pepper, cut into 1 1/2-inch squares
1 orange bell pepper, cut into 1 1/2-inch squares

For the Scallion Sauce

15 scallions, very thinly sliced
1/4 cup fish sauce
3 tablespoons vegetable oil
2 tablespoons Kikkoman® Soy Sauce
2 tablespoons toasted sesame seeds

  1. Place the beef cubes in a large sealed plastic bag. Add the Kikkoman® Teriyaki Marinade & Sauce and seal the bag, pressing out as much air as possible. Transfer the bag to the refrigerator and marinate the beef for 6 to 8 hours.
  2. Thread the beef onto metal skewers, alternating with the onion and colorful bell peppers. Discard the marinade.
  3. Combine all the ingredients for the scallion sauce in a large bowl just before you begin grilling; stir occasionally and add extra Kikkoman® Soy Sauce depending on your taste preference.
  4. Light a gas or charcoal grill. Grill the skewers over direct high heat until the beef is well-seared on all sides, about 3 to 4 minutes per side. Brush the skewers all over with additional Kikkoman® Teriyaki Marinade & Sauce. Cover the grill and continue to cook until the center of the beef is medium. Transfer the skewers to a platter and let it rest for 5 minutes. Serve immediately with the scallion sauce on the side for dipping.
